Output e67fc3653a8bf7f3eeca0859c85e11cdb47bb0d65dccc824b8331d4973ea0b7e:1

value
551778
script pubkey
OP_0 OP_PUSHBYTES_20 d97c1234ba372ba20ffef69c4bf438b18565c576
address
bc1qm97pyd96xu46yrl776wyhapckxzkt3tkpxk03c
transaction
e67fc3653a8bf7f3eeca0859c85e11cdb47bb0d65dccc824b8331d4973ea0b7e
confirmations
179
spent
true